Farmers blame Trump for biofuels rule they view as betrayal
Story Date: 10/17/2019

 

Source: David Pitt, WRAL, 10/16/19

 Agriculture commodity groups and some farmers expressed frustration and anger Wednesday with a rule released by the Environmental Protection Agency that they said fails to uphold a promise President Donald Trump made 12 days ago to fulfill the intent of an ethanol law passed by Congress. Since Trump became president, the EPA has given 85 oil refineries exemptions from blending ethanol into the gasoline they sell.
